Publisher Description:
The interests of the capitalist and those of the worker are, therefore, one and the same, assert the bourgeois and their economists. Indeed The worker perishes if capital does not employ him. Capital perishes if it does not exploit labour power, and in order to exploit it, it must buy it. The faster capital intended for production, productive capital, increases, the more, therefore, industry prospers, the more the bourgeoisie enriches itself and the better business is, the more workers.
